About Biharia Village

Biharia is one of the larger villages in Hariharpara tehsil, in the district of Murshidabad, West Bengal.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 12,282, made up of 6,343 males and 5,939 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 936 females per 1000 males. The village covers 1725.81 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 742175,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Biharia

The census records public bus service for Biharia as Available within 10+ km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
